Distributed Denial of Service (DDoS) Attacks
Distributed Denial of Service (DDoS) attacks can severely disrupt financial operations. These attacks overwhelm a network with excessive traffic, rendering services unavailable. He may experience significant downtime during such incidents. This disruption can lead to financial losses and damage to reputation.
Moreover, DDoS attacks can serve as a smokescreen for other malicious activities. While the network is busy, attackers may exploit vulnerabilities elsewhere. Organizations must implement robust mitigation strategies to counteract these threats. Effective measures include traffic analysis and rate limiting. He should also consider employing DDoS protection services. Awareness of these risks is essential for maintaining operational integrity. Proactive planning can minimize potential impacts.

Utilizing Two-Factor Authentication
Utilizing two-factor authentication (2FA) significantly enhances security for financial transactions. This method requires users to provide two forms of verification before accessing accounts. He should implement 2FA to protect sensitive information effectively. By combining something he knows, like a password, with something he has, like a mobile device, the security level increases.
Moreover, 2FA can deter unauthorized access even if passwords are compromised. He must ensure that all employees understand its importance. Regular training on how to use 2FA is essential. Organizations should akso evaluate the effectiveness of their 2FA systems periodically. Continuous improvement is vital for maintaining robust security.

Data Encryption Techniques
Data encryption techniques are essential for protecting sensitive information. By converting data into a coded format, he ensures that only authorized users can access it. This process significantly reduces the risk of data breaches. Implementing strong encryption algorithms, such as AES, is crucial for safeguarding financial assets.
Additionally, he should encrypt data both at rest and in transit. This dual approach provides comprehensive protection against unauthorized access. Regularly updating encryption protocols is also necessary to counter evolving threats. He must stay informed about the latest encryption standards. Awareness of potential vulnerabilities is vital for maintaining security. Strong encryption practices build trust with clients.
